Default smoke coming from heater switches

Can anyone tell me how to remove the dashboard in a 1996 blazer, i cant seem to find the sqrews or clips holding it on. I need to access the area behind the heater controls, i have smoke coming out and i want to prevent a wire fire. Thank you.

Default RE: smoke coming from heater switches

first welcome, second- there are 2 screws in the guage cluster area, then i believe that the rest just snaps out. you should be able to see your screws holding the switchs on after popping off the front face trim. try running a search to find all the info you need. there is alot of helpfull info in here.
